Description

1- Add a Resource of the Composed Web Page type
2- In the resource edit page, check the Show the course blocks box.
3- Save and display
4- Logged in as admin or teacher, in the Administration block you have access to the Turn Editing on link.
5- Click on that link...
6- Error * Course Module ID was incorrect*.

This bug seems to have gone on unnoticed for quite a long time (at least since version 1.8).
See also this discussion: http://moodle.org/mod/forum/discuss.php?d=63730
where Stephen Smith complains that "The administrator button 'turn editing on/off' appears to have disappeared" and John Isner answers "If you could edit the resource page, you could add or remove blocks. Then the blocks on the resource page would no longer be the same as on the main course page, and the resource would need to maintain its own list of blocks. I doubt that resources can do that."

My conclusion is that the Turn Editing on link should NOT appear in this context and it should be removed to fix the bug.
